From 9d9b21040d30649658de6950ad5fbb619d0ca802 Mon Sep 17 00:00:00 2001 From: Patrik Holmqvist Date: Fri, 17 Jan 2025 12:54:28 +0100 Subject: [PATCH] Add backup node parameter to class --- .../etc/puppet/modules/net/manifests/baas2_restoretest.pp |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/global/overlay/etc/puppet/modules/net/manifests/baas2_restoretest.pp b/global/overlay/etc/puppet/modules/net/manifests/baas2_restoretest.pp index 309f36c..214c7db 100644 --- a/global/overlay/etc/puppet/modules/net/manifests/baas2_restoretest.pp +++ b/global/overlay/etc/puppet/modules/net/manifests/baas2_restoretest.pp @@ -2,7 +2,8 @@ # This tests the backup and restores when manged by sunet::baas2 from puppet-sunet # Jira-ref: SUNETOPS-1997 class net::baas2_restoretest( - Enum['backupnode', 'restorenode'] $node_type = undef, + Enum['backupnode', 'restorenode'] $node_type, + String $backup_nodename, ) { file { '/opt/baas2': @@ -57,7 +58,7 @@ class net::baas2_restoretest( } sunet::scriptherder::cronjob { 'baas2-validate-backup-files': - cmd => '/opt/baas2/validate-backup-files', + cmd => "/opt/baas2/validate-backup-files ${backup_nodename}", minute => '5', hour => '8', ok_criteria => ['exit_status=0', 'max_age=48h'],